在Jupyter中图片路径找不到在哪看
时间: 2024-10-25 11:08:12 浏览: 40
在Jupyter Notebook中,如果你试图显示一个图片,但是提示路径找不到,你可以按照以下步骤查找:
1. **检查文件位置**:确保图片文件位于你指定的路径下,并且该路径是在你的工作目录内或者被正确地添加到`sys.path`中(如果是外部文件夹)。Jupyter默认的工作目录通常是notebook所在的文件夹。
2. **查看文件路径**:在代码单元格里尝试加载图片的地方,打印出你要访问的完整路径,确认路径是否正确无误。
```python
import os
print(os.getcwd()) # 打印当前工作目录
print(os.path.abspath('image.jpg')) # 如果图片名为image.jpg,检查这个路径
```
3. **相对或绝对路径**:考虑使用相对路径(相对于notebook所在文件夹)或绝对路径(从根目录开始计数)。
4. **更改工作目录**:如果图片不在当前目录下,你可以使用`os.chdir()`函数改变工作目录。
5. **重启Kernel**:有时候,因为Jupyter Kernel缓存了旧的信息,你可能需要先关闭并重新启动Kernel,再尝试加载图片。
如果上述步骤都没问题,但是依然无法找到,可能是网络问题或者是Jupyter本身的问题,可以试着清除缓存、重启Jupyter或更新到最新版本看看。
相关问题
jupyter看不到图片
可能是因为你的jupyter notebook没有正确设置图片的路径。你可以尝试使用相对路径或绝对路径来引用图片。如果你使用的是相对路径,那么图片应该与你的notebook文件在同一个目录下或者在子目录中。如果你使用的是绝对路径,那么你需要指定完整的路径,包括盘符和文件夹路径。
另外,你也可以尝试使用以下代码来显示图片:
```python
from IPython.display import Image
Image(filename='path/to/image.png')
```
其中,`filename`参数应该是图片的路径。
为什么jupyter图片找不到
可能有几个原因导致 Jupyter Notebook 找不到图片:
1. 图片路径不正确:确保指定的路径是正确的,并且图片文件存在于指定的位置。可以使用绝对路径或相对路径指定图片路径。
2. 图片文件格式不受支持:Jupyter Notebook 通常支持常见的图片格式(如 PNG、JPEG),但不支持其他格式(如 SVG)。确保你尝试加载的图片格式是受支持的。
3. Jupyter Notebook 内核问题:有时候,由于内核问题,Jupyter Notebook 可能无法正确加载图片。尝试重新启动内核并重新运行代码。
4. 权限问题:如果你没有足够的权限访问图片文件或所在目录,Jupyter Notebook 将无法加载图片。确保你具有适当的权限。
如果仍然无法解决问题,可以提供更多详细信息,如代码示例和错误消息,以便我能够更好地帮助你。
阅读全文